Alphapet acquires Healthfood 24


Jan 30, 2020
Alphapet Ventures, a pet supplies company specialising in digital solutions, has acquired the German pet food manufacturer Healthfood 24 and thus added the Wolfsblut and Wildcat pet food brands to its brand portfolio. Alphapet was already the biggest and most important online distribution partner for Healthfood 24, according to the former.

Following the acquisition, the Wolfsblut and Wildcat brands will continue to be developed independently under the aegis of Alphapet Ventures, according to a press release by Alphapet. Distribution will be widened via the Alphapet subsidiary Premium Pet Products and its distribution teams plus field sales service.

In the wake of the transaction, the private equity investor Capiton has acquired 36 per cent of the shares in Alphapet with its "capiton V" fund, thereby financing the acquisition. Apart from Capiton, Muzinich & Co. has also provided acquisition financing to support the transaction.

The takeover has yet to be approved by the Federal Cartel Office.
